Press Release Body = Planning orders for optimized picking is the most essential
aspect in the order fulfillment process. QC OMS (order management system) is a
configurable tool that allows orders to be streamlined for picking efficiency.
Utilizing the Wave Planner and Scheduling functions, the most efficient picking
technique will be determined whether you are processing single line/single quantity
orders, multiple line orders, or ship alone orders.

QC OMS releases the proper number of Pick Tasks to maintain a fluid work load.
QC OMS also provides functionality to select the proper carton(s) for shipping an
order. As orders are released, QC OMS analyzes the makeup of each order to select
the proper sized shipping container. The cubing algorithm first attempts to
allocate all items for an order to a single shipping container. If multiple
shipping containers are required, QC OMS then allocates items to the various
containers based on pick zone location in order to minimize the number of containers
routed to each zone for a single order.

Orders that are processed through QC OMS may be picked utilizing various
technologies. Pick tasks can be accomplished using a combination of manual and/or
automated solutions such as pick tickets, carousels, Pick-To-Light (PTL), and RF
terminals. QC OMS also allows for multiple picking methods such as Batch Picks,
Cluster Picks, and Order Picks.

As containers are delivered to the various pick zones, QC OMS transmits Pick Request
messages to the local pick controller, identifying the container ID and associated
line items (SKU, location, and corresponding quantities) to be picked. The local
pick controller then notifies QC Navigator when each pick is complete via a Pick
Complete message. QC OMS uses these messages from the various picking sub-system
controllers to track the status of each order and ensure order integrity. QC OMS
tracks the status of the order throughout the process and provides real time
management statistics.
